1.) Cafe Jordano

Location: 11068 W. Jewell Ave, Lakewood, CO 80227

The Italian Restaurant only takes reservations for a group of more than 6 people to offer consideration to its neighboring restaurants. Cafe Jordano's menu features the classic Italian dishes which are particularly prepared by an Italian family. It operates for more than 20 years and opens for lunch from Monday through Friday and dinner from Monday through Saturday.

2.) Valkarie Gallery and Studio

Location: 445 S. Saulsbury St, Lakewood, CO 80226

Opened in 2013, a vision of Valerie Savarie and Karrie York provides various artists with a collective exhibition space and creative creation. They aim to produce a family atmosphere for both the exhibition artists and residents. Visitors can view the works of Josh Davy, Dorothy DePaulo, Miki Harder, Kim Anderson, Aria Fawn, and many others. They have showcased different types of media from traditional forms such as photography, painting, and drawing to crafting media such as book sculpting, paper cutting, and jewelry.

3.) Crown Hill Park

Location: 9357 West 26th Ave, Wheat Ridge, CO 80033

Crown Hill Park offers the visitors of suburban Colorado a place for admiring various bird species, relaxing, and enjoying outdoor lakeside recreation activities. Visitors can go fishing, horseback riding, hiking, picnicking, biking, rollerblading, walking, jogging, and wildlife viewing. A wildlife sanctuary is also located in the northwest corner of the park.

4.) Lakewood Heritage Center

Location: 801 S. Yarrow St, Lakewood, CO 80226

The local history of Lakewood is highlighted in the Lakewood Heritage Center. This compromises the various changes throughout the century in terms of inventions and lifestyle of the city. The center is located within Belmar Park which houses historic buildings, a museum, a festival area, 30,000 artifacts, and an outdoor amphitheater. There are also historical tours and a gift shop for visitors.

5.) Bear Creek Greenbelt

Location: 2800 S. Estes St, Lakewood, CO 80227

The 3.5 miles out and back trail in Lakewood is the perfect place for walking, hiking, and leisure adventure for all ages. Visitors can find an along the shore path, majestic bridges, a large pond, wetlands, and an open meadow in the Bear Creek Greenbelt.

6.) William F. Hayden Green Mountain Park

Location: 1000 S. Rooney Rd, Lakewood, CO 80228

The second-largest park in Lakewood, William F. Hayden Green Park has more than 2,400 acres of broad open space. It is commonly known for hikers that enjoy multi-use and challenging trails that lead to the top of Green Mountain. The summit will give the visitors a unique and magnificent view of the surrounding areas. The ground of the mountain park is also home to different species of wildlife which include haws, mile deer, bluebirds, and rabbits.

7.) Great Frontier Brewing Company

Location: 2010 S. Oak St, Lakewood, CO 80227

This brewing company boasts itself on great tasting and quality handcrafted beer that contains Gluten-Free and Gluten-Reduced beer. The history of creating the first gluten-free beer is incorporated with the foundation of the Great Frontier Brewing Company. Several awards were also won by Blondie Annie, the first gluten-free beer.

9.) Blue Sky Cafe

Location: 14403 W. Colfax Ave, Lakewood, CO 80401

Blue Sky Cafe, which serves breakfast and lunch, is a locally owned and operated cafe in Lakewood. Apart from offering a wide range of dishes, the cafe also has a juice and coffee bar that turns into a yoga studio during the night. One of the main objectives of the cafe is to serve their guests foods that are equally delicious and healthy hence they guarantee that they only use the freshest and natural ingredients. Their dishes also contains no preservative and only uses healthy fats and oils.

10.) 240 Union

Location: 240 Union Blvd, Lakewood, CO 80228

240 Union-A Creative Grill offers a variation of American contemporary cuisines in Lakewood. The restaurant is particular in fresh seafood, lamb dishes, specialty pasta, and wood-fired pizzas. This distinctive showroom-type restaurant is a great choice if you want to enjoy an upscale but still casual dining experience with your friends and family.

11.) Bear Creek Lake Park

Location: 15600 W. Morrison Rd, Lakewood, CO 80228

A hidden gem that is located in a center of three different lakes in the foothills of Lakewood is the Bear Creek Lake Park. Some of the main attractions that visitors can found in the lake park include fishing, biking, camping, and boating. The Bear Creek Lake is great for motorized boating, which is open from March 15 until November 15, since it is surprisingly huge with its size of about 100 acres. It also has 47 campsites, three cabins, and 15 miles of trails. Visitors can also enjoy activities in the lake park such as archery, horseback riding, and hiking.
